Have you ever felt an uncanny pull towards a decision that seems illogical, only to discover it was the best choice you could have ever made?

Welcome to the enchanting world of intuition and spirit guides!

In my conversation with Erin Rogers, my personal Intuitive Mentor & Channel, we navigate through the terrain our innate, intuitive wisdom and its deep ties with our personal traumas and healing.

I also (bravely! lol) share an intimate account of my connection with my Spirit Team!!

Erin and I also chat about astro-cartography, a branch of astrology that offered me insights on why I gravitated towards certain countries or cities throughout my life.

Erin shares her personal journey of , going from 15 years of working in the corporate world, to finally surrendering to her intuition and making the boldest move of her life!

Also....
Did you know that the unseen world communicates with us in myriad ways, if we're receptive to its messages?

Later in our interview, we discuss the fine line between intuition and channeling, and how channeling can be a full-body experience offering safety, guidance, and unconditional love.

Speaker 2:

We love that. So astro-cartography is the astrology of place. The way I like to describe it is the planets, moon and stars are included. We're in a certain configuration in the sky when you were born and you can basically take that configuration and overlay it on a world map and that world map that's unique to you will show you the places on the world where you can experience those energies, and it's unique to everybody and it has the different sort of angles.

Speaker 2:

So there's always four sides to each of the planets, and what I really loved about it was that and human design for me personally, where they created a possibility, where I saw that some of the ways I was wasn't to be fixed but to be embraced. And then I'm someone who also has lived all over the world and I was like, oh, and I keep going to places that have really significant energy for me Probably not a coincidence and I loved the tool because the tool got me to, got me started. It was easier to use a tool than to admit my other skills, which is all good. And, yeah, I love your other skill more.
